Tankist Biography

Tankist is a thrash metal band formed in Estonia in 2013 whose essence lies in boldly exploring the diverse facets of old school thrash. A constant at the region’s metal festivals, they are best known for their defiant nature and feral live energy.

The band emerged as a power trio of troublemakers from a rural village of 40 inhabitants to play rude retro thrash as straightforward as Sodom and Slayer. These first notoriously raw cellar band days were spent untamed in the sweat-ridden underground while pulling stunts like recording anti-religious metal in the local church for the rebellious Be Offended EP.

By 2017, Tankist had expanded to a four-piece to deliver the eccentric and no less provocative debut LP Unhuman, abundant in intricate riffs touching on the technical end of thrash. The release met acclaim and left critics struggling to pinpoint lookalikes. Though some noted Kreator and Megadeth influences, suddenly progressive comparisons like Voivod, Watchtower and Mekong Delta began cropping up.

In 2023, Tankist released their sophomore concept album Forced Equal, condemning totalitarian regimes on the gruesome example of Soviet forced labor camps. With this unique mix of blackened death-thrash akin to avant-garde, Tankist has shifted towards the cold aggression of Baltic and Scandinavian extreme metal. For now.
